I have gotten the filler blocks for the bow and stern installed and shaped. The transom frames are in and at the correct angle. The outer transom frames lean back to match the transom and they also lean in to match the angle of the hull. I have also gotten the waterways installed. It's not real clear as to the instillation of the waterways and the planksheer. I was looking at some other builds and saw some builders installed the waterways first and then the planksheer, while others did it just the opposite. It doesn't show it on the plans, but the the waterways are faired at about a 45deg to just above the height of the deck planks.
